Homeowners placing a property in the hands of a construction team expect reliability at every stage, particularly when undertaking major structural improvements. Residential projects across London and Essex can involve extensions, refurbishments, internal alterations and basement conversions, often requiring numerous trades to work together efficiently. A dependable construction process starts with understanding the objectives of the homeowner and establishing how the work can be delivered safely and practically. From there, quality depends on coordination. Structural specialists, electricians, plumbers, plasterers, decorators and other trades may all contribute to a single transformation, meaning workmanship needs to remain consistent throughout the project. Basement construction makes this especially clear. Excavation and structural support establish the physical space, waterproofing protects it, building services make it functional and skilled finishing turns it into an enjoyable part of the property. Weakness in any one stage can affect the quality of everything that follows. Reliable builders therefore consider the complete construction process rather than concentrating exclusively on the most visible elements. This coordinated approach also helps establish trust with homeowners, who can have greater confidence that structural details and finishing standards are being treated with equal importance. The result should be a residential space that feels professionally built, carefully finished and genuinely integrated with the existing home.
